CRIMINAL LAW - Appeal against conviction and sentence - One count of intentionally causing injury and two counts of resisting a police officer in the execution of duty - Whether trial judge erred in directing jury on requirements of a lawful arrest - Direction that information obtained from 'Intergraph' was sufficient to found a reasonable basis for belief that applicant had committed an indictable offence - Whether judge should have told jury that applicant must hear words of arrest, or whether it was sufficient for his Honour to direct that words must be 'hearable' - Whether judge adequately summarised submissions of counsel - Whether judge erred in failing to accede to jury request that parts of transcript be read - Appeal allowed.
